What was the Federalists view of the Constitution

The Federalists believed in a strong central government, with little power given to the states. They implied that the constitution allowed the government to oversee and handle most of the day to day operations of states.

The <u>Federalists</u> view the Constitution as a safeguard to the liberty and independence the American Revolution had created before, so they considered this document essential to constitute a stronger national government.

Among other things, <u>Federalists</u> argued that national government only had the powers granted under the Constitution, that the Constitution provided balance through three branches of government and that the system of checks and balances si fundamental to the proper functioning of the three branches.

People with high scores in ____________ seem to have more pleasant relationships.
Elan Coil [88]

Answer:

Extroversion, agreeableness, and conscientiousness

Explanation:

The NEO-5 big five factors were proposed by Paul Costa and McCrae. In this personality test, five major traits are measured by this personality test. There are OCEAN five major traits.  

Agreeableness: The person who scores high on this trait show different characteristics such as  

  • The person will interest other people
  • Show care about other people

Extroversion: The person who shows a high score on this trait is enjoy the center of attraction. This type of personality likes to start a conversation with other people.  

Conscientiousness: The person who will score high on this category will be organized, pay attention to the information and finish the task at the right time in the right way.  

Thus the person who scores high on these traits will have more pleasant relationships.
